Career path

Career Role (Urban Policy Negotiation) Description
Urban Planner Develops and implements strategies for sustainable urban growth, requiring strong negotiation skills with stakeholders. High demand, excellent career progression.
Policy Advisor (Urban Development) Advises government bodies on urban policy, negotiating with diverse interest groups. Significant influence, strong analytical skills required.
Negotiator (Land Acquisition & Redevelopment) Secures land rights for urban development projects, expertly negotiating complex deals. High-stakes environment, excellent earning potential.
Community Liaison Officer (Urban Regeneration) Facilitates communication and negotiates agreements between urban development projects and local communities. Strong communication and interpersonal skills essential.
Urban Regeneration Consultant Provides expert advice on urban regeneration projects, negotiating funding and partnerships. Wide-ranging experience, strategic thinking vital.
